Ask for a breakdown of all the costs involved: 1 price for your shingles, a single for your labor of removing the old kinds and installing the new ones, as well as a contingency funds that outlines the costs In case your roofer discovers that sheathing or other elements must be replaced.

Metallic roofing is resilient, needs no upkeep and demonstrates warmth. Metal roof panels can also be lightweight and straightforward to setup. Metal roof hues fluctuate by product, which ranges from steel and aluminum to copper and zinc. A well-liked choice is corrugated roof panels, which include interlocking steel sheets that type repeated waves or ridges.

Just before supplying you with an estimate, a contractor need to evaluate all parts in and close to your roof, such as the drip edge and gutters that steer water runoff. In a whole roof restore or redo, you’ll ordinarily need to have to replace the underlayment. That part, usually dealt with paper or artificial sheets, serves to be a weather conditions barrier atop the sheathing or decking, that is the flat area—normally product of oriented strand board (OSB) or plywood—that lies within the rafters. In a cold weather, a roofer may perhaps recommend applying an ice-dam defense membrane in a few spots to protect versus h2o seepage brought on by ice buildup. Adding or updating the ridge vent and vented soffits can increase attic airflow and forestall hazardous humidity buildup.
